An opportunity has arisen for a Research and Policy Officer to join a leading support body within the educational sector based in Belfast. This is a Full-Time, Temporary Position initially for 6 months. Working hours: 36 hours. Typically, 9am-5pm. (Hybrid working) With a salary of £17.62 - £19.42 per hour (dependent on experience). Start date: Immediate.

Job Role: You will be responsible for the development, delivery, analysis and reporting of the research, policy and public affairs objectives set out in the company's strategy. This will include providing updates on education and related policy developments and legislation which may impact on the controlled sector as well as monitor, advise and report on the consultation processes within the organisation.

Essential Criteria:

  • Previous experience within a similar role.
  • Experience of producing reports and undertaking research and policy projects.
  • IT proficient.
  • Excellent communication skills both written and verbal - with the ability to communicate with stakeholders at all levels.
  • Ability to work on your own initiative as well as part of a team.
  • Ability to manage and prioritise a busy workload.

Main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Monitor policy, legislative and other developments relevant to the organisation and identify implications and advise SMT accordingly.
  • Contribute to and where required produce reports to government consultations for internal and external stakeholders, (e.g. press articles factsheets) to ensure effective communication of relevant policy related matters.
  • Work with SMT to develop and undertake research and policy projects to support the delivery of strategic objectives.
  • Advise and support the team, when necessary, in aiding their responding to education policy matters.
  • To develop bespoke surveys, to include preparation, analysis and reporting.
  • Assist with the organising events and dissemination activities.
  • Establish and maintain a stakeholder grid.
  • To undertake any other relevant and appropriate duties which may be reasonably allocated.
